All professional sports teams in the Twin Cities cancelled their games on Monday following an officer-involved shooting in Brooklyn Center, Minn.

The Twins were the first to announce the cancellation of their series opener with the Boston Red Sox. The game was called off about an hour before the scheduled first pitch.

The Timberwolves and Wild also announced the cancellations for their games Monday night.

The Wild's game against St. Louis has been rescheduled for May 12th.

The Timberwolves were scheduled to take on Brooklyn Nets on Monday night at the Target Center.
